Pong Revived

Posted by Jim • Comments (2)

 This wonderful news from LikeCool.  I don’t know, something in me kicks in when people talk about Pong.  Maybe because I was one of the “fortunate” few who actually stayed up real late so I can touch that Atari paddle and try a game of Pong.  And that was after a long line of 20 elementary school classmates who wanted their fair shot too.  Yeah, that was the hip thing my friend… nothing like being there when everything was in their baby stages.This Pong table, boy is something to look out for.  Designed by Moritz Waldemeyer, aiming to re-create that feeling way back 70′s when it was a real worldwide hit.  This tabletop has 2,400 LEDs and two track pads embedded in its surface.  When the game’s turned off, it sits like any other table.I am unsure if this is in its concept stage or would be available soon.
